Later that evening, Elsa found herself on a mountain miles from Arendelle. She was safe, but had no idea what to do.
Inside her head, Anger, Fear and Disgust decided to retire for the evening, despite Elsa being awake.
“Ohhh..." Sadness moaned. “I guess we have to do this ourselves."
Sadness pulled a switch which filled Elsa with regret. She was all alone on the north mountain because she failed to conceal her power.
“I have a better idea," Joy said, pushing Sadness aside. With the clicking of a few buttons, she recalled a sad memory of Elsa pulling on gloves with her father by her side.
“Don't let them in, don't let them see
“Be the good girl you always have to be
“Conceal, don't feel
Don't let them know"
“Joy, how is that supposed to help?" Sadness asked, confused. Normally, Joy wants Elsa to be happy.
“Well..." Joy smiled, pushing a button.
With that, Elsa ripped off her last glove and was finally free to use her powers.

Throughout the rest of the evening, Elsa rebuilt Olaf, her childhood snowman, built a palace out of ice, even her wardrobe was crafted with her powers.
When the sun shone that morning, a light flashed in Headquarters as a new Core Memory was formed. This one was just yellow, but Joy was amazed as it reconstructed Winter Island.

The following evening, Joy and Sadness took a look at the Core Memories and Personality Islands. But Joy was mostly interested in the new Core Memory and Winter Island.
“Isn't it beautiful?" she asked her fellow Emotion. “It's like it returned from the dead. But not in a creepy way, of course."
“Yeah, I guess," Sadness mumbled, unsure.
“Well, what's your favorite Core Memory?" Joy asked.
“The one from the coronation," she replied, pointing at the yellow and purple Core Memory.
“You sure?" Joy questioned the blue Emotion. “It does seem a little abnormal."
“I thought it was nice when you and Fear worked together," Sadness explained. “These other ones just don't look complete."
As Sadness reached for one of the original Core Memories, it started to turn blue. But Joy pulled her hand away before she could touch it.
“No, no, no, don't touch, remember?" Joy said, pressing a button so the Core Memory holder would return to the floor. “If you touch them, they stay sad."
“Sorry, I won't," Sadness assured, looking away. Apparently, she turned all of the day's memories sad.
“Starting... now."
